## Deployment

Linkline handles all deep-link routing for the Pebbleworth mobile apps. Deploys go through the standard Orchard pipeline: merge to main triggers a build, and promotion to production requires one approval from the routing team. Note that the route manifest is baked into the artifact at build time, so any change to path patterns requires a full redeploy, not just a config push. The router pod reads the following configuration values at startup:

service settings:
[silwyn]
host = silwyn.crelvogrid.internal
user = silwyn_svc
database = silwyn_prod

## Session Handling for Health Checks

The Corvel gateway sits behind the Lanternside load balancer, which probes /healthz every ten seconds. Health-check requests are stateless by design: they bypass the session store entirely so that probe traffic never inflates session counts or evicts real user sessions. New team members should note that the deep-check endpoint, /healthz/deep, does verify session-store connectivity and therefore requires authentication. When probing it manually, supply the token below.

bearer token for tajep-kajef: eyJhbGciOiJIUzI1NiIsInR5cCI6IkpXVCJ9.eyJzdWIiOiIoOsZ23In0.CsygO0hs

Internal Memo — Budget Request

To the sales leads: Operations has submitted a budget request to fund two additional demo kits for the Vellane product line and travel support for the Ashgrove territory push. Finance expects a decision within two weeks. No changes to current spending limits until then; log any urgent needs with your regional coordinator. Background on the request's purpose appears below.

board note of fahaf-fadug: Gilixax Logistics is in early talks to buy Praiusax Partners for about $8.1 million. The Pramir launch date is September 23, and nothing goes to the press before then.

Before archiving, verify the bucket's retention policy has expired and no active restore jobs reference it. Run the pre-archive validation script, which checks object lock flags and lifecycle rules. Once validation passes, submit an archive request through the Glacierport console; the operation is irreversible after the 48-hour grace window. Document the bucket name and archive timestamp in your review notes. For edge cases or policy exceptions, contact the storage platform team directly.

escalation mailbox, fawep-tahop: quenvan@nelvrostack.internal